Building Community Through Burgers and Shakes: Virginia’s Journey with Re:Grub
Meet Virginia Borges, the passionate co-owner of Re:Grub, a vibrant burger and milkshake restaurant with two locations in Calgary. Virginia’s entrepreneurial journey began with a desire to create a unique dining experience that brings joy and community together. We caught up with her in the Beltline location on 11th Ave SW to chat about her experience as an entrepreneur.
What initially sparked your interest in starting a restaurant?
I always wanted to have my own business. Coming to Canada from Venezuela as an international student, I didn’t have the resources but had the dream and willingness to learn. In 2015, I partnered with Jose, and we started Re:Grub. Initially, we aimed to create a trendy bar-like space for young people, but when we put the first donut on a milkshake, it went viral. Seeing the excitement and happiness from customers, especially kids, made me realize this was what I wanted to pursue.

What do you love most about Re:Grub and the work you do?
The smiles and reactions from our customers when they see our shakes are priceless. It’s incredibly fulfilling to see their joy. Additionally, working with a program to hire people with diverse abilities was a highlight for me. We had about 20% of our employees from this program, giving full-time jobs to those with different abilities. It was a period of immense learning and growth, both for me and the business.
